Re: [問題]iphone sdk IB

看板MacDev作者 (小書&小昭)時間15年前 (2010/09/08 10:12), 編輯推噓0(000)
留言0則, 0人參與, 最新討論串3/4 (看更多)
看到你這篇我才發現我原文中的問題出現在那裡 導致那位版友會噓我.... 我東西不多的意思是 中文可參考資料不多!! 跟中文網站介紹的資料不多的意思 我少打了幾個字@@"~ 在此跟m版友道歉一下....... sdk開發平台的api之健全 是我目前看過最恐怖的....... 原本一開始接觸sdk時 是打算自已重建api 但沒想到幾乎什麼樣的物件類別全都建好好的 等著讓我去用@@"~~~我根本不用去動api.. 只要再包個函式去呼叫跟修改數值就好了!! 真的是超方便的.... ※ 引述《zonble (zonble)》之銘言: : ※ 引述《wayne1985 (小書&小昭)》之銘言: : : 請問imageview 可以把背景設成透明色嗎?? : : 我讀進了一張png的圖..背景是白色 : : 我想把那個白色設成透明色!! : : 實在是..iphone的東西實在不是很多!! : : → BlueKidds:那是圖的問題 要去修圖 跟iphone SDK較沒關係 09/07 19:36 : : → BlueKidds:iphone負責把你load近來的圖作呈現 它不是一個改圖軟體 09/07 19:36 : iPhone 上面有可以將某個顏色變成透明的 API,去查一下關於 : CGImage 的 mask 相關的文章就有了。或是直接看蘋果的文件: : http://0rz.tw/sZLDb : 簡單來說,要將某個顏色變成透明,就是要設一個遮照(mask) : 這個被遮住的部份就會變成透明。要設定遮照大概有幾個方法, : 其一是用另外一張黑白圖片設定我們原本圖片的對應範圍,黑白 : 圖片中黑色的留下來,白色的就去掉,或是指定某個顏色,只要 : 是這個顏色就去掉(比較精確來說,是 RGBA 值的某個範圍)。 : 可是不管怎樣,只要看到白色背景就自動變成透明背景,而不打 : 算自己修圖,會有非常大的問題-是不是白色就是背景?在前景 : 的物品中,如果出現了一圈白色,這個白色到底是這個物品裡頭 : 有個洞呢?還是因為是亮面所以是白色?通常來說,在最基本的 : UI元件上,比較不會提供這種 API,因為單純看點陣圖裡頭的每 : 個 pixel,其實沒有辦法理解其實到底你想要做什麼。 : 簡單弄了一個「去掉白色背景」的東西,應該就可以知道我的意 : 思:http://drp.ly/1Glwbi : 話說回來,既然說 iPhone API 不多,那麼是不是哪個別的平台 : 的 SDK 有提供辨識白色背景的 UI 元件?我是知道排版軟體可以 : 找到插入的點陣圖如果有白色背景,就可以根據背景範圍自動設 : 定外框做文繞圖…不過這種狀況又不一樣,反正文繞圖的時候, : 也不會因為圖裡頭有的白洞,就把文字塞進去。 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 122.118.42.15
文章代碼(AID): #1CXl46tt (MacDev)
討論串 (同標題文章)
本文引述了以下文章的的內容:
完整討論串 (本文為第 3 之 4 篇):
-1
11
文章代碼(AID): #1CXl46tt (MacDev)